BIT Mining Limited has shown an impressive upward trajectory with its recent earnings statement. The company’s quarterly revenue has surged to over $32.92M, courtesy of a revamped business model and cost-effective operations. Although the path seemed challenging with fluctuating stock prices in the weeks leading up to their earnings release, the revealing figures have provided a much-needed boost in morale.

The company’s pre-tax profit margin is notably steep at 244.8, indicating a lucrative financial stance despite some hiccups in profitability ratios. Such metrics have caught the eyes of seasoned investors, pushing them to reconsider BTCM’s position in their portfolio.

On the balance sheet, total assets sit comfortably at over $86.33M, a testament to the growing value and stability BIT Mining Limited is achieving. A slight leverage ratio of 1.5 signifies calculated risks taken by the management, making room for substantial growth while maintaining a sturdy foundation.

Directing focus towards its fiscal health, BTCM’s enterprise value is hovering around $26.95M, hinting toward favorable opportunities for stakeholders. Considering the PE ratio of 2.37, investment risks seem lower compared to many contemporaries, although speculative leaps in crypto valuations could sway these numbers.

The available research on day trading suggests that most active traders lose money. Fees and overtrading are major contributors to these losses.

A 2000 study called “Trading is Hazardous to Your Wealth: The Common Stock Investment Performance of Individual Investors” evaluated 66,465 U.S. households that held stocks from 1991 to 1996. The households that traded most averaged an 11.4% annual return during a period where the overall market gained 17.9%. These lower returns were attributed to overconfidence.

A 2014 paper (revised 2019) titled “Learning Fast or Slow?” analyzed the complete transaction history of the Taiwan Stock Exchange between 1992 and 2006. It looked at the ongoing performance of day traders in this sample, and found that 97% of day traders can expect to lose money from trading, and more than 90% of all day trading volume can be traced to investors who predictably lose money. Additionally, it tied the behavior of gamblers and drivers who get more speeding tickets to overtrading, and cited studies showing that legalized gambling has an inverse effect on trading volume.

A 2019 research study (revised 2020) called “Day Trading for a Living?” observed 19,646 Brazilian futures contract traders who started day trading from 2013 to 2015, and recorded two years of their trading activity. The study authors found that 97% of traders with more than 300 days actively trading lost money, and only 1.1% earned more than the Brazilian minimum wage ($16 USD per day). They hypothesized that the greater returns shown in previous studies did not differentiate between frequent day traders and those who traded rarely, and that more frequent trading activity decreases the chance of profitability.

These studies show the wide variance of the available data on day trading profitability. One thing that seems clear from the research is that most day traders lose money .
